Replaced crank shaft sensor but no fire?

Check for power to the sensor. check for power and ground to the Ignition coil. If the crank sensor is adjustable, make sure that it is set to the proper gap.

What is the difference between a cam shaft sensor an a crank sensor?

A cam sensor tells the computer when number one compression stroke is happening, the crank sensor tell the computer when to fire the sparkplugs.
